Achieving Zzzs for Conception Success

Want to conceive faster? Then you should focus on your sleep. A good night's rest is more than just feeling refreshed; it's crucial for regulating your hormones, which play a big role in conception. Women who get enough sleep have higher chances of optimizing their menstrual cycle and elevating their chances of conceiving. For men, adequate sleep can maximize sperm production and quality.

Make shut-eye a priority in your journey to parenthood! Here are some tips for getting those vital Zzzs:

* Stick to a consistent sleep schedule every day, even on weekends.

* Create a relaxing bedtime ritual including a warm bath or reading.

* Make sure your bedroom is dark, quiet, and cool.

* Avoid caffeine and alcohol before bed.

The Vital Connection Between Sleep and Fertility

Adequate slumber is essential for overall well-being, but its role in reproductive health is often overlooked. Studies have shown a strong association between sleep quality and chances of getting pregnant. When we ensure sufficient slumber, our bodies synthesize essential hormones that control the menstrual cycle and elevate chances of fertilization.

  • Hormonal balance
  • Optimal release of eggs
  • More fertile eggs

Conversely, chronic sleep deprivation can negatively impact these processes, leading to irregular cycles. By optimizing our sleep patterns, we create the conditions for a successful journey into parenthood.
